(c) INJUNCTIONS.—Section 34(a) (15 U.S.C. 1116(a)) is amended in the first sentence by inserting "or to prevent a violation under section 43(a)" after "Office". (d) NOTICE OF SUIT TO COMMISSIONER.—Section 34(c)

(15 U.S.C.

1116(c)) is amended— (1) by striking out "proceeding arising" and inserting in lieu thereof "proceeding involving a mark registered"; and (2) by striking out "decision is rendered, appeal taken or a decree issued" and inserting in lieu thereof "judgment is entered or an appeal is taken". (e) CIVIL ACTIONS ARISING FROM U S E OF COUNTERFEIT MARKS.—

Section 34(d)(l)(B) (15 U.S.C. 1116(d)(l)(B)) is amended by inserting "on or" after "designation used". SEC. 129. RECOVERY FOR VIOLATION OF RIGHTS.

Section 35(a) (15 U.S.C. 1117(a)) is amended in the first sentence by inserting ", or a violation under section 43(a)," after "Office". SEC. 130. DESTRUCTION OF INFRINGING ARTICLES.

Section 36 (15 U.S.C. 1118) is amended in the first sentence— (1) by inserting ", or a violation under section 43(a)," after "Office"; and (2) by inserting after "registered mark" the following: "or, in the case of a violation of section 43(a), the word, term, name, s3anbol, device, combination thereof, designation, description, or representation that is the subject of the violation,".
